Can You Get Into Grad School If...

In undergrad I failed a few classes? How does it work?

It may depend on your GPA as some graduate programs do not admit applicants with a GPA below a certain number (regardless of whether you failed a course or not). And I agree with wanton that it will also depend if those classes were in the field you wish to study (if not, admissions may be willing to overlook it).
